Introduction
The Collectors Corner Museum, nestled at 900 John Adams Pkwy in Idaho Falls, ID, is a hidden gem that transports visitors back in time through its vast collection of antique toys, dolls, and other nostalgic items. This unique museum is a must-visit for collectors, history enthusiasts, and those seeking a glimpse into the past.
Main Services
- Antique Toy and Doll Collection: The museum houses an extensive collection of antique toys and dolls, dating back to the late 19th century. Visitors can explore a wide range of brands, including Barbie, Hot Wheels, and Mattel, among others.
- Nostalgia Items: Apart from toys and dolls, the museum also displays a variety of nostalgic items that evoke fond memories of yesteryears. This includes advertisements, board games, and other pop culture artifacts.
- Educational Tours: The Collectors Corner Museum offers guided tours that provide visitors with an in-depth understanding of the history and evolution of toys and dolls. These tours are both entertaining and educational, making them perfect for both adults and children.
- Gift Shop: The museum features a well-stocked gift shop where visitors can purchase souvenirs, replica toys, and other collectibles. It's an excellent opportunity to take a piece of history home.
